This season, the IHSAA decided to make the Regional a one-game affair to win a title, with two Regional games at the same host site, similar to past Semi-States. Therefore, there will now be two Regional winners at each site. The Semi-States will be a four-team, three-game event next Saturday, where teams in each class must win twice to advance to the State Finals. Vernon (Fortville) (19-6), 4:00 p.m. ET</p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><strong>Game-1:</strong> Brownsburg defeated Lawrence North, 59-52, back on December 29th. The two teams are a bit of a contrast stylistically, as Lawrence North likes to push tempo and pressure the ball, while Brownsburg prefers to play efficiently, execute in the half-court, and play good, sound defense. Lawrence North looks to Senior wings [player_tooltip player_id='155437' first='Monica' last='Williams'] and [player_tooltip player_id='127212' first='Laniya' last='Early'] to provide the spark, as both are long, athletic, and can make plays at either end of the floor. They get help on the perimeter this year from Junior [player_tooltip player_id='572824' first='Kamara' last='Mills'] and Sophomore [player_tooltip player_id='295799' first='Kya' last='Hurt']. Sophomore post [player_tooltip player_id='295793' first='Jamaya' last='Thomas'] is big, strong, physical, and hard-working, and it's going to take everything she has to combat 6-6 Sophomore post [player_tooltip player_id='295789' first='Avery' last='Gordon'] of Brownsburg. The Lady Bulldog center is also strong and physical, and it's difficult to keep her from establishing position inside. Gordon is the key for Brownsburg, because of her size, so if she's able to stay on the floor for long periods of time, the Bulldogs have the advantage. Senior [player_tooltip player_id='59780' first='Kailyn' last='Terrell'] is a feisty, tough-nosed lead guard for Brownsburg, and Junior [player_tooltip player_id='201875' first='Emma' last='Hendricks'] is a dangerous perimeter shooter. But it all starts and ends with Gordon for the Bulldogs. I will take Brownsburg, barely, because of Gordon's size and Terrell's leadership. However, if Lawrence North can attack Gordon and get her in foul trouble early, this game could flip quickly. Still, give me Brownsburg in a nail-biter, 51-49.</p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><strong>Game-2:</strong> This game ought to be fun, as these same two teams met last year in the Regional, with Ben Davis prevailing, 53-49. Mt. Vernon is down three key starters from a year ago, while the Lady Giants didn't graduate nearly as much production. The Giants return a great deal of size, length, and athleticism. 6-3 Senior post [player_tooltip player_id='203653' first='Cristen' last='Carter'] has significantly stepped up her offensive game from a year ago, and fellow Senior [player_tooltip player_id='96082' first='Taylor' last='Guess'] has also been much more impactful. Junior [player_tooltip player_id='572797' first='Zoe' last='Wheeler'] has given them a nice boost offensively, and Junior [player_tooltip player_id='177331' first='Scottlynn' last='Johnson'] has provided an additional interior presence. For the Lady Marauders, Junior [player_tooltip player_id='177344' first='Ellery' last='Minch'] is as versatile as they come. She can battle some inside, play in the mid-post, or handle the ball and knock down shots outside. They will likely need her inside for much of this contest. Senior [player_tooltip player_id='372347' first='Khloe' last='Patterson'] is all energy all the time. She feeds off of emotion, and as long as she can maintain focus, she could be a matchup problem for Ben Davis. I also liked the potential I saw in Sophomore Kenyonrae Kenny earlier this year. She is a long, athletic playmaker, but she will take chances. As long as she can minimize her turnovers, she could be a definite x-factor in this game. I like Ben Davis because of their experience, though Mt. Vernon has talent of their own. With that said, I'll take Ben Davis over Mt. Vernon - <strong>Kaitlyn Laffey</strong>, 2024 - 5.3p, 2.0r</p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><font color="#FFFFFF">.</font></p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><strong><font size="+2">Bedford North Lawrence Regional:</font></strong><br>Game-1: Center Grove (21-4) vs. Franklin Community (18-5), 4:00 p.m. ET<br>Game-2: Evansville Central (15-11) vs. Bedford North Lawrence (23-3), 7:00 p.m. ET</p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><strong>Game-1:</strong> Located just 9.3 miles apart, Center Grove and Franklin are terribly familiar with one another. The Grizzly Cubs knocked off the Lady Trojans, 38-34, back in mid-November, dropping Center Grove to a 4-4 start to the season. The Trojans haven't lost since, rattling off 17 consecutive victories. Franklin started their season 3-3, and they've now won 15 of 17 games, including eight in a row. This should be a really interesting matchup, and it could be a dogfight in the 30s, or an offensive explosion in the 60s, especially considering the quality of perimeter play each team possesses. Center Grove has incredible balance in their backcourt, with Seniors [player_tooltip player_id='59756' first='Ella' last='Hobson'] and [player_tooltip player_id='59729' first='Savanna' last='Bischoff'], Junior [player_tooltip player_id='177311' first='Aubrie' last='Booker'], and Sophomore [player_tooltip player_id='295755' first='Lilly' last='Bischoff'] each averaging between 5.7 and 6.6 points per game. Add to that Junior wing [player_tooltip player_id='264111' first='Audrey' last='Annee'], and they can be lethal from the perimeter. Franklin can match that, as they have knocked down 209 3-pointers as a team through 22 "statted" games this season (<em>online stats incomplete from their first matchup with CG</em>). The Grizzly Cubs have seven players who've knocked down 15 or more 3-pointers this year, so they come at you from all positions. Juniors [player_tooltip player_id='177336' first='Scarlett' last='Kimbrell'] (<em>45 made 3s</em>) and [player_tooltip player_id='455947' first='Brooklyn' last='York'] (<em>36 made 3s</em>), plus Senior [player_tooltip player_id='300067' first='Kyndell' last='Jochim'] (<em>31 made 3s</em>) top the list. This is honestly probably a pick'em game, since these two teams match up about as well as any in the Regional round. I will lean slightly towards Center Grove, though, for no reason other than their two-and-a-half-month win streak. Final score: 45-39.</p> <!-- /wp:paragraph --> <!-- wp:paragraph --> <p><strong>Game-2:</strong> Hats off to a young Evansville Central team who handled their business in Sectional #16 with a trio of nice wins over Castle, Evansville North, and Jasper. Their core of Freshman [player_tooltip player_id='492324' first='Madalyn' last='Shirley'], Sophomore Delaney Steers, and Junior [player_tooltip player_id='572806' first='Mackenzie' last='White'] give the Lady Bear faithful a lot of hope for more success in the near future. This weekend, however, it will take a small miracle for Central to compete with Bedford North Lawrence. The Lady Stars will be the best Indiana team Central has faced this year, and Bedford comes at you with a tremendously talented backcourt. Senior [player_tooltip player_id='59766' first='Karsyn' last='Norman'] will receive a lot of Miss Basketball votes this year, while Junior [player_tooltip player_id='176409' first='Chloe' last='Spreen'] will be in the hunt for the award a year from now. They are dynamic as shooters, scorers, and facilitators. Junior [player_tooltip player_id='177308' first='Madisyn' last='Bailey'] is another skilled, hard-working guard who can produce consistently. The Stars have also gotten a nice season from Senior wing [player_tooltip player_id='574554' first='Mallory' last='Pride']. I have a feeling Bedford, who is used to this spotlight, takes advantage of some Central nerves early and often and controls this one from the tip.
